Benefits of Using Infrastructure Inspection Robots

Integrating infrastructure inspection robots into maintenance routines yields several key benefits:

  • Enhanced Safety: Traditional inspection methods often require workers to enter potentially hazardous environments. Robots can access hard-to-reach areas without putting human life at risk.

  • Cost Efficiency: Over time, using robots reduces the need for extensive labor and minimizes the risk of accidents, which can be costly.

  • Data Accuracy: Equipped with advanced sensors and imaging technology, these robots deliver precise data which improves the decision-making process.

  • Speed: Inspections that might take days can often be completed in a fraction of the time, allowing for quicker repairs and maintenance.

Types of Infrastructure Inspection Robots

Different types of infrastructure inspection robots address specific needs within various sectors:

Aerial Drones

  • Ideal for inspecting roofs, bridges, and large structures.
  • Equipped with cameras to provide real-time footage.
  • Capable of covering large areas in a short time.

Ground Robots

  • Best suited for inspecting pipelines, underground structures, and railways.
  • Often designed to navigate rough surfaces or confined spaces.
  • Can collect data on material integrity and other critical metrics.

Underwater Robots

  • Essential for inspecting dams, piers, and submerged pipelines.
  • Operate in challenging aquatic environments where humans cannot easily access.
  • Equipped with sonar and specialized tools for underwater evaluations.

Common Problems with Infrastructure Inspection Robots

Despite their benefits, users may encounter certain challenges when implementing infrastructure inspection robots. Here are solutions for some common issues:

Limited Range of Operation

  • Problem: Some robots may not cover extensive areas due to battery life or signal limitations.
  • Solution: Utilize robots with extended battery capabilities or incorporate drone technology for higher altitudes and broader coverage.

Data Overload

  • Problem: Robots generate vast amounts of data that can be overwhelming to analyze.
  • Solution: Implement data analytics software that can filter and prioritize essential information.

Technical Malfunctions

  • Problem: As with any technology, robots can experience malfunctions.
  • Solution: Regular maintenance and scheduled software updates can mitigate issues. Training staff on basic troubleshooting is also essential.

Best Practices for Implementing Infrastructure Inspection Robots

To make the most of infrastructure inspection robots, consider the following best practices:

  1. Conduct Training Sessions: Ensure staff members are well-trained in operating the robots and interpreting the data.

  2. Invest in Quality Equipment: Choose robots that suit the specific inspection needs of your infrastructure.

  3. Create a Maintenance Schedule: Regularly check and maintain the robots to ensure they function effectively and efficiently.

  4. Collaborate with Experts: Partnering with firms that specialize in robotics can provide insights and technical support.

  5. Utilize Data for Predictive Maintenance: Leverage the data collected for predictive maintenance to prevent issues before they escalate.
